I found the old way Firefox opened on the last page I was looking at very useful and I hate the way it opens in the new version. I usually keep several tabs open and dwelling on old topics I have researched. It now completely ignores that and forces me to open on a useless tab requiring me to search through several tabs before finding the one I was on. How can I defeat this useless new function and get my old browser functionality back?

Chosen solution

Just go to Settings > About Firefox > Tap 5 Times > Debug: Toggle Start at Home: ON
